Block 21389389

0xf2a8f935cb66a1ca474d7c2b9b8f83c94e03846a6839aff015e50d6555e243f5
Transactions0
Height21389389
Confirmations342212
TimestampWed, 01 Jan 2025 18:14:49 UTC
Size (bytes)537
Version
Merkle Root
Nonce0xba080c14124c3eba
Bits
Difficulty0xc8e80d9800ffb